How much does a Brock Law Firm Assistant make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for an Assistant at Brock Law Firm is $40,848, which translates to approximately $20 per hour. Salaries for Assistant at Brock Law Firm typically range from $37,145 to $43,977,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Brock Law Firm, Providing Residential and Commercial Real Estate Services to Western North Carolina. Located in downtown Asheville.
